In re ComUnity Lending Inc.

In re ComUnity Lending Inc.

Ruling
Attorneys' fees incurred in ERISA action against debtor gave rise to general unsecured claim.
Procedural posture

Former employees of the debtor who prevailed in an action against the debtor under the Employee Retirement Income Security Act (ERISA), 29 U.S.C.S. § 1001 et seq., filed a motion asking the court to determine that the attorneys' fees they were awarded for prevailing in the ERISA action should be paid as an administrative expense of the debtor's chapter 7 estate.
